Overview of Texas Instruments THS3115CD
The Texas Instruments THS3115CD is a high-speed, current-feedback operational amplifier that is designed to deliver exceptional performance for a wide range of applications. This op-amp is part of the THS3115 series, which is known for its high output current drive capability and excellent signal fidelity. The THS3115CD is particularly suitable for applications requiring high bandwidth, low distortion, and high output current.
Key Features
- High Output Current: The THS3115CD can deliver an impressive output current of ±420 mA, making it ideal for driving heavy loads.
- Wide Bandwidth: It offers a wide bandwidth of 145 MHz at a gain of +2, ensuring that signals are amplified without significant loss of detail or fidelity.
- Low Distortion: With a total harmonic distortion (THD) of -75 dBc at 1 MHz, the THS3115CD maintains signal integrity, resulting in clear and precise amplification.
- Fast Slew Rate: The op-amp provides a fast slew rate of 2000 V/µs, which contributes to its ability to handle rapid signal changes and high-frequency components.
- Stable Operation: It is designed for stable operation with capacitive loads up to 1 nF, which is crucial for maintaining performance in complex circuits.

Package and Quality
The THS3115CD is offered in an 8-pin SOIC package, which is compact and suitable for space-constrained applications. Additionally, Texas Instruments ensures high-quality standards, providing reliable and consistent performance across various operating conditions.
